From: Pavel Modilaynen <[email protected]> Use close-on-exec (O_CLOEXEC) flag when open log file to make sure its file descriptor is not leaked to parent process on fork/exec.
Fixes [YOCTO #13311] Signed-off-by: Mingli Yu <[email protected]> Signed-off-by: Yoann Congal <[email protected]> --- pseudo_util.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/pseudo_util.c b/pseudo_util.c index 64636b7..b58036f 100644 --- a/pseudo_util.c +++ b/pseudo_util.c @@ -1611,7 +1611,7 @@ pseudo_logfile(char *filename, char *defname, int prefer_fd) { } free(filename); } - fd = open(pseudo_path, O_WRONLY | O_APPEND | O_CREAT, 0644); + fd = open(pseudo_path, O_WRONLY | O_APPEND | O_CREAT | O_CLOEXEC, 0644); if (fd == -1) { pseudo_diag("help: can't open log file %s: %s\n", pseudo_path, strerror(errno)); } else { -- 2.30.2
